/**
* Java implementation of bubble sort
*
* @author Carlos Abraham Hernandez (abraham@abranhe.com)
*/
public class BubbleSort {
void bubbleSort(int arr[]) {
for (int i = 0; i < arr.length - 1; i++)
for (int j = 0; j < arr.length - i - 1; j++)
if (arr[j] > arr[j + 1]) {
int temp = arr[j];
arr[j] = arr[j + 1];
arr[j + 1] = temp;
}
}
